Selvas Last Name Facts
Where Does The Last Name Selvas Come From? nationality or country of origin
The last name Selvas is more frequently found in Mexico than any other country/territory. It can also occur as a variant: Selvás. For other possible spellings of this name click here.
How Common Is The Last Name Selvas? popularity and diffusion
It is the 250,767th most frequently used last name globally, held by approximately 1 in 4,609,453 people. It occurs mostly in The Americas, where 94 percent of Selvas are found; 89 percent are found in North America and 87 percent are found in Hispano-North America. It is also the 1,116,575th most frequent forename worldwide It is held by 75 people.
The last name Selvas is most numerous in Mexico, where it is held by 1,371 people, or 1 in 90,537. In Mexico Selvas is most frequent in: Chiapas, where 74 percent are found, Mexico City, where 5 percent are found and México, where 5 percent are found. Without taking into account Mexico Selvas exists in 16 countries. It also occurs in Spain, where 5 percent are found and Argentina, where 3 percent are found.
Selvas Family Population Trend historical fluctuation
The incidence of Selvas has changed over time. In The United States the share of the population with the surname grew 410 percent between 1880 and 2014.
